Deficiency record · 2

13 - Propulsion and Auxiliary Machinery › N/A - No Subsystem › Operation of machinery
Issued 18 May 2021 Resolved
Vessel throttles default to idle when coming up to speed. Demonstrate proper operation as design by manufacture.
Action required: 17 - Rectify deficiencies prior to departure
Resolved 25 May 2021
Resolution: Vessel corrected the use and got underway for sea trial.
11 - Life Saving Appliances › N/A - No Subsystem › Means of rescue
Issued 18 May 2021 Resolved
Unable to conduct MOB due to throttle issue. Be able to demonstrate effective MOB.
Action required: 17 - Rectify deficiencies prior to departure
Resolved 25 May 2021
Resolution: Vsl completed effective MOB.
